Here is each degree level offered in engineering at Tarleton,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.
| Degree Level |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Bachelor’s | 60 |
| Master’s | 3 |
The engineering area of study at Tarleton breaks down into these majors. Choose a major for its full rankings, popularity, and outcomes:
| Major |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Mechanical Engineering | 35 |
| Civil Engineering | 11 |
| Electrical, Electronics, and Communications Engineering | 8 |
| Environmental/Environmental Health Engineering | 7 |
| Computer Engineering | 2 |
In the most recent year for which we have data, Tarleton State University conferred 3 master’s degrees in engineering.
Tarleton is not currently ranked for engineering at the master’s level.
Every one of the 3 students who graduated with a master’s degree in engineering from Tarleton identified as men.
The largest share of engineering master’s degree graduates at Tarleton are White. Roughly 67%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Tarleton State University with a master’s in engineering.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 0 |
| Black or African American | 1 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 0 |
| White | 2 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 0 |
